    About the Speaker
    Abdi Aidid researches and teaches in the areas of civil procedure, torts, and law & technology. He is currently an Assistant Professor at the University of Toronto Faculty of Law. He received his BA from the University of Toronto, his JD from Yale Law School and his LLM from the Faculty of Law, University of Toronto. Professor Aidid previously practiced litigation and arbitration at Covington & Burling LLP in New York City and most recently served as the VP, Legal Research at Blue J, where he oversaw the development of machine learning-enabled research and analytics tools. Professor Aidid is a Faculty Affiliate at the Centre for Ethics and a member of the Ethics of AI Lab.
